EFCC Arrest Buhari’s Minister, Hadi Sirika

Voice Air Media, News Update

THE Economic and Financial Crimes Commission (EFCC) has arrested a former Minister of Aviation, Hadi Sirika, in connection with an ongoing investigation related to money laundering amounting to N8,069,176,864.00.

Voice Air Media understands that the accused ex-Minister of Aviation appeared at the EFCC’s Federal Capital Territory Command around 1:00 pm on Tuesday.

Sirika is presently in questioning by EFCC investigators regarding alleged fraudulent contracts he authorized for a company called Engirios Nigeria Limited, which is owned by his younger sibling, Abubakar Sirika.
